The custom format helpers `createPropertyFormatter` does not support passing formatting options
In the createPropertyFormatter
function, I can't pass in custom formatting attributes, because it will be overridden by hard-coded prefix='--'
This code should be changed like this, could you support the fix of this problem?

https://github.com/amzn/style-dictionary/pull/1165 once this is merged and released in v4.0.0-prerelease.27, you will be able to do it like so:
{
destination: 'variables.css',
format: 'css/variables',
options: {
formatting: {
indentation: ' ',
},
},
}
indentation just being one example but the other props work as well such as prefix etc.
